Patient's Query

Hello doctor,

I recently started having issues with my bowels for about a month. I have had sudden constipation and stool issues. When I do go, my bowels are thin and soft around the edges. I do have constant pressure in my lower stomach, and it hurts if pressed upon. I have tried exercise, probiotics, fiber supplements, and increasing my water intake. I have had incidents when I could not make it to the restroom because I suddenly needed to go with no warning.

I am currently on 75 mg Venlafaxine daily and have had a Mirena IUD for three years. I did have an x-ray done of my stomach about a year ago, and the doctor noted there was a large amount of bowels in my colon, but nothing was suggested at the time. Please help.

If the problem were only with your intestine motility, it would have been called to a certain extent using probiotics and laxatives. If the problem does not seem to decrease with the use of symptomatic medications, then we will have to evaluate why the motility of your gut has reduced. The usual causes in such cases are electrolyte imbalance, mainly calcium and potassium.

I would advise you to get your electrolytes checked that are sodium, potassium, and calcium. If these are normal, then the most common causes of such problems will be ruled out.

I would also advise you to change your diet to include a little less roughages and a bit more spice, which would stimulate the motility of your bowels. Keep the fixed timing of your food intake, eating food at different times on different days will hamper your gut's motility.

You can also get your thyroid profile check for hypothyroidism, which can cause such problems.
